#9D17FD Color
#9D17FD is rgb(157, 23, 253) in RGB, hsl(275, 98%, 54%) in HSL, and about cmyk(38%, 91%, 0%, 1%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Extreme Violet (#9F00FF),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.63.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#9D17FD Channel Values
How #9D17FD bre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 157 · G 23 · B 253 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 275° · S 98% · L 54%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 275° · S 91% · V 99%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 38% · M 91% · Y 0% · K 1%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 5.28:1 vs white · 3.97: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#9D17FD background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#9D17FD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#9D17FD?
#9D17FD is a mid-tone purple — rgb(157, 23, 253) in RGB and hsl(275, 98%, 54%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Extreme Violet (#9F00FF),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.63.
What is the RGB value of #9D17FD?
#9D17FD is rgb(157, 23, 253) — red 157, green 23, and blue 253 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#9D17FD?
#9D17FD converts to approximately cmyk(38%, 91%, 0%, 1%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#9D17FD be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#9D17FD scores 5.28:1 against white and 3.97: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#9D17FD as a CSS color keyword?
No. #9D17FD is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is blueviolet (#8A2BE2) at a CIE76 distance of 16.11, which is visibly different.
